Fed stated that interest rate cut pricing is 'overly optimistic'

Risk appetite in the markets remains low after Goldman Sachs stated that the market is overly optimistic regarding Fed interest rate cuts.

The S&P 500 closed Monday with a 0.5 percent loss after reaching its March 2022 peaks. The decline in US stock futures continues this morning. The losses have also spread to Asia. The MSCI Asia Pacific index is preparing to close its third consecutive trading day with a loss. Hong Kong's Hang Seng and Japan's Nikkei 225 are leading the losses in Asia.

The Bloomberg Dollar Index is flat at 1,240 points. The Australian dollar is decoupling negatively with a 0.6 percent loss following dovish statements regarding inflation from the Reserve Bank of Australia, which kept interest rates steady at 4.35 percent. The US 10-year bond yield is hovering flat at 4.26 percent. Statements from the Saudi prince have not provided support to oil prices for now. After closing Monday with a drop of over 2 percent following damage to optimism regarding Fed interest rate cuts, an ounce of gold is up 0.3 percent at the 2,036 dollar level.

GROUND OPERATION IN GAZA EXPANDS

Israel announced that it is expanding its ground operations in the Gaza Strip toward the south of the strip. Israel Defense Forces spokesperson Daniel Hagari stated in a statement on Monday that the attack is progressing "house by house, tunnel by tunnel." In his statement, which did not refer to US warnings regarding civilian casualties, Hagari merely said that the targets were based on "precise intelligence." On the other hand, a warning came from Turkey after Ronen Bar, the director of the Israeli Security Agency, said they were determined to kill Hamas members all over the world, including in Lebanon, Turkey, and Qatar. According to Anadolu Agency, it was reported to Israeli intelligence units that there would be serious consequences for engaging in illegal activities in Turkey.
